Indian families love to celebrate, and festivals are an integral part of their lives. Diwali, the festival of lights, Holi, the festival of colors, and Navratri, a nine-day celebration of dance and music, are just a few examples of the many festivals that bring families together. These celebrations are not just about revelry; they're also about reconnecting with tradition, strengthening family bonds, and passing down cultural heritage.

No discussion of Indian daily life is complete without the festivals that interrupt and elevate it. Whether it is Diwali, Eid, Pongal, or Christmas, the Indian household transforms during celebrations.

Morning often includes small acts of devotion, such as lighting a lamp, practicing yoga , or reciting prayers to set a positive tone.
